tools: ynl: decode link types present in tests

Using a kernel built for the net selftest target to run drivers/net
tests currently fails, because the net kernel automatically spawns
a handful of tunnel devices which YNL can't decode.

Fill in those missing link types in rt_link. We need to extend subset
support a bit for it to work.
